Transaction 954657abcef91fa5b109358ca2a5ad212b7474a5a5b180fabebe59c10a3414cd

1 Input
1 Outputs
  • 954657abcef91fa5b109358ca2a5ad212b7474a5a5b180fabebe59c10a3414cd:0
  • value  1481222
    address  1GNy7Euaiea8ffsUbQWbMAGcrgSvTDFpDe